Description:

As a Health Care Aide (HCA), you will work as a collaborative member of the multidisciplinary team, providing personal assistance by supporting activities of daily living and delivering support services to patients (clients, residents) who require short term assistance or ongoing support, in accordance with the patient care plan and facility policies and procedures. In this role, you will work closely with patients, families, and caregivers across the continuum of care in home, community, and health care facilities. You will assist nurses with the provision of routine care to meet patients' hygiene, nutrition, mobility, recreation, and safety needs; assist with organized activities or programs; and observe and report on patients' mood, health, and wellbeing. Working under the supervision of a regulated health professional, you will assist in maintaining a safe environment for patients, staff, and visitors, while supporting effective communication with patients and health care professionals. Required Qualifications:

Active or eligible for registration or practice permit with the College of LPNs and HCAs of Alberta (CLHA) as a Health Care Aide, along with proof of education or completion of Health Care Aide Certificate within 18 months of hire.

Additional Required Qualifications:

Current Heart & Stroke Basic Cardiac Life Support - Health Care Provider (BCLS-HCP). Acute care experience within the past 2 years. Ability to balance numerous demands and conflicting priorities is essential. Basic computer skills.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Good command of the English language. Ability to work as part of a team and with minimal supervision. Physical capability of performing all aspects of the role (bending, crouching, kneeling, overhead lifting, and mobilization of bariatric patients).

Preferred Qualifications:

Emergency experience within the past 2 years. Connect Care training.
